Handbook of Gay, Lesbian, Bisexual, and Transgender Administration and Policy

Recording issues and obstacles as well as groundbreaking victories in the recognition of gay, lesbian, bisexual, and transgender (GLBT) rights in politics and policy, this landmark handbook introduces core considerations necessary for prompting governmental initiatives and social structures to better serve the GLBT population. It addresses surfacing and often underemphasized administrative concerns, such as changes in marriage and human rights laws, the growing recognition of transgender rights in the U.S., and issues of youth and aging within the gay demographic. The impressive scope of this handbook will serve anyone involved in GLBT public administrative theory and practice at any level.
